Lithologic Log
(Log data entered from KOLAR.) | ||
From: 0 ft. to 15 ft. | brown sandy silt trace clay | |
From: 15 ft. to 34 ft. | brown fine to medium sand | |
From: 34 ft. to 40 ft. | gray fine to medium sand, trace gravel | |
From: 40 ft. to 53.3 ft. | fine to medium sand, some gravel |
